Montérégie is actually an administrative region of the Province of Québec. Within Montérégie, there are three subregions each consisting of Regional County Municipalities (municipalité régionale de comté - "MRC") or equivalents:

Longueuil

An urban agglomeration equivalent to an RCM consisting of several boros as well as a subregion of Montérégie.


Montérégie-Est

A subregion consisting of a number of RCMs

  • Acton
  • La Vallée-du-Richelieu
  • Le Haut-Richelieu
  • Les Maskoutains
  • Marguerite-D'Youville
  • Pierre-De Saurel
  • Rouville

Vallée-du-Haut-Saint-Laurent

A subregion consisting of a number of RCMs

  • Beauharnois-Salaberry
  • Le Haut-Saint-Laurent
    • Dundee
    • Elgin
    • Franklin
    • Godmanchester
    • Havelock
    • Hinchinbrooke
    • Howick
    • Huntingdon
    • Ormstown
    • Saint-Anicet
    • Saint-Chrysostome
    • Sainte-Barbe
    • Très-Saint-Sacrement
  • Les Jardins-de-Napierville
  • Roussillon
  • Vaudreuil-Soulanges
    • Coteau-du-Lac
    • Hudson
    • L'Île-Cadieux
    • L'Île-Perrot
    • Les Cèdres
    • Les Coteaux
    • Notre-Dame-de-l'Île-Perrot
    • Pincourt
    • Pointe-des-Cascades
    • Pointe-Fortune
    • Rigaud
    • Rivière-Beaudette
    • Saint-Clet
    • Saint-Lazare
    • Saint-Polycarpe
    • Saint-Télesphore
    • Saint-Zotique
    • Sainte-Justine-de-Newton
    • Sainte-Marthe
    • Terrasse-Vaudreuil
    • Très-Saint-Rédempteur
    • Vaudreuil-Dorion
    • Vaudreuil-sur-le-Lac
